Ballard Partners Expands Ballard Global Alliance Through Strategic Partnership with Global Nexus in Mexico City

WASHINGTON, DC – Ballard Partners, a leading international public affairs and lobbying firm, is pleased to announce the expansion of the Ballard Global Alliance through a strategic partnership with Global Nexus, a government and public affairs firm with offices in Mexico City and Washington, DC.

This partnership marks a significant milestone for both firms. For Ballard Partners, in combination with its partnerships in Brazil and Argentina, it strengthens Ballard’s ability to provide clients with seamless and effective public affairs services across the Western Hemisphere. For Global Nexus, the collaboration enhances its operational capacity and builds on its well-established presence in Washington, D.C., expanding its reach across other key U.S. policy hubs.
